2013 SESSION
13104146DBe it enacted by the General Assembly of Virginia:
1. That the Code of Virginia is amended by adding in Article 2 of Chapter 1 of Title 64.2 a section numbered 64.2-109 as follows:
§ 64.2-109. Limitations on penalty clause for contest.
A provision of a will or trust instrument purporting to penalize an interested person for contesting the will or trust or instituting other proceedings relating to an estate or trust is unenforceable with respect to an action that does not question or challenge the validity of the will or trust but instead seeks only to interpret or enforce the instrument or to assure that it is administered pursuant to its terms and applicable law.
